![]() Studies have shown that drivers in the US are at higher risk of skin cancer, especially on their left side owing to exposure to UV rays while driving. Even though it’s rare to get a sunburn through a car window, what’s surprising is that harmful ultraviolet rays still affect you, contributing to skin cancer and premature aging. How to protect yourself from harmful UV Rays? The Skin Cancer Foundation recommends that people follow a complete sun protection regimen that includes an SPF 15—or higher—sunscreen. An effective sunscreen is not only important when you’re outdoors; you need to use it even when you’re indoors—especially when you’re out on the road in your car. That’s where tinted windows come in! In fact, studies have shown that there was a notable left-sided predominance in skin cancer patients who used automobiles, except for people who had tinted windows in their vehicles. There’s no denying that prevention of skin cancer and window tinting go hand in hand, so a high-quality window tint is non-negotiable when driving in the sun! How can window tints help prevent skin cancer? Ultraviolet rays damage your skin on a cellular level, leading to age spots, wrinkles and leathering. Did you know that UVA rays are the root cause of about 90% of non-melanoma skin cancers in the US? UVB rays, on the other hand, cause immediate damaging effects like blisters and burns, leading to long-term skin damage. Millions of Americans are exposed to the sun while traveling in their vehicles. On average, people spend about 294 hours on the road per year. Unfortunately, windshield glass and windows aren’t sufficient for resisting harmful UV rays, leaving you exposed.
